Garden care services encompass a range of tasks designed to keep outdoor spaces healthy, attractive, and functional. These services typically include lawn mowing, trimming shrubs, planting flowers, and removing weeds. By maintaining the yard regularly, homeowners can enjoy a tidy and inviting landscape without the hassle of doing the work themselves. Professional garden care can also involve seasonal tasks such as aerating the soil, fertilizing plants, and preparing gardens for winter, ensuring the landscape remains vibrant and well-kept throughout the year.
One common reason homeowners seek garden care services is to address overgrown or unruly landscapes. Over time, lawns can become patchy or overrun with weeds, and shrubs may grow too tall or become misshapen. Regular maintenance helps prevent these issues from escalating, keeping the yard looking neat and preventing pests or disease from taking hold. Garden care professionals can also assist with pruning to promote healthy plant growth, removing dead or damaged branches that could pose safety hazards or diminish the property's curb appeal.

The overview below groups typical Garden Care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Yakima,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or garden care tasks like pruning or weed removal usually range from $50 to $200.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, though prices can vary based on the size and scope of the project.
Lawn Maintenance - Regular lawn care services such as mowing, edging, and fertilizing often cost between $30 and $70 per visit. Larger or more frequent service plans may increase the overall expense but remain within this common range.
Planting & Landscaping - Installing new plants, shrubs, or small landscape features generally costs from $250 to $600 for many smaller jobs. More extensive landscaping projects can reach $2,000 or more, depending on complexity and scale.
Full Garden Overhaul - Complete redesign or major renovations tend to start around $3,000 and can go beyond $10,000 for large, detailed projects. Many projects fall into the $5,000 range, with fewer reaching the highest tiers based on size and customization need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
